996tt in Wallingford, CT

I am considering this car. Carfax indicates it was leased in northern CA and then returned to Porsche. Dealer didn't buy back and put in internal Porsche pool (not Mannheim) and the Wallingford dealership bought it. Seems as though on sale there for 7-8 months, original price was 74,995 now offered at 59,995 and I think they will go to around 55k. Has anyone dealt with this dealer. Does anyone know anything about this car. I was planning on driving down there this weekend to give it a spin. Dealer says reason it has not sold is it does not have heated seats.

Hey man,
After looking at the car if you're interested in it I suggest you have a good independent Porsche shop give the car a through inspection (PPI).

I recommend calling Fairfield County Motorsports and having them do a PPI. They are only maybe ~30miles from Wallingford... Here is their website: http://www.fairfieldcountymotorsport.com/ Ask for Drew.

Good luck!
